What does it take to stay awake when the reality is tough and home is far away? Using archival footage of the Sunflower Movement that took place in Taipei, Taiwan in 2014 as a starting point, the filmmaker reflects on her ideas of home, politics, and the importance of being present.
In search of a better future, Milay moved from Cuba to the United States with her parents, leaving her motherland for the first time. After struggling to build a new life there, the family finally visits Cuba, allowing Milay to fulfill her dream of celebrating her quinceañera in her hometown.
